Identification of low-frequency TRAF3IP2 coding variants in psoriatic arthritis patients and functional characterization.

Beate Böhm | Harald Burkhardt | Steffen Uebe | Maria Apel | Frank Behrens | André Reis | Ulrike Hüffmeier
Arthritis research & therapy | 2012

In recent genome-wide association studies for psoriatic arthritis (PsA) and psoriasis vulgaris, common coding variants in the TRAF3IP2 gene were identified to contribute to susceptibility to both disease entities. The risk allele of p.Asp10Asn (rs33980500) proved to be most significantly associated and to encode a mutant protein with an almost completely disrupted binding property to TRAF6, supporting its impact as a main disease-causing variant and modulator of IL-17 signaling.
